Summary Introduction
To explain:
In what way a houseplant becomes bushier if its terminal buds are pinched off.
Concept introduction:
Apical dominance is a phenomenon in which the apical bud suppresses the growth of lateral buds. As a result, the lateral growth of the plant does not occur.
